Basic information Supplier

1368594-82-4(1H-Indole, 7-fluoro-1,3-dimethyl-)

Basic information Supplier
1368594-82-4 Basic informationMore

Browse by Nationality 1368594-82-4 Suppliers >China suppliers

Recommend You Select Member Companies